论坛首页 Java企业应用论坛

测试hibernate的join通不过,不知道是什么原因!!!

浏览 10196 次
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(0)
作者 正文
   发表时间:2003-12-23  
OracleDialect,Oracle8Dialect,Oracle9Dialect 早就 试过了 ,都报同样的错误 , 如果真是不支持,
请问用什么方式可以达到同样的功能?
0 请登录后投票
   发表时间:2003-12-23  
用OracleDialect也产生一样的sql?不可能吧?
0 请登录后投票
   发表时间:2003-12-23  
是的刚刚又试了一次:
主要配置如下:
<property name="hibernate.connection.driver_class">oracle.jdbc.driver.OracleDriver</property>
        <property name="hibernate.connection.url">jdbc:oracle:thin:@localhost:1521:hibeTest</property>
        <property name="hibernate.connection.username">luomi</property>
        <property name="hibernate.connection.password">110809</property>
        <property name="hibernate.connection.pool.size">20</property>
        <property name="hibernate.dialect">net.sf.hibernate.dialect.OracleDialect</property>

结果提示:

alter table BLOG_ITEMS drop constraint FK5FDFB8C329868AD8

drop table BLOG_ITEMS cascade constraints

drop table BLOGS cascade constraints

drop sequence hibernate_sequence

create table BLOG_ITEMS (
   BLOG_ITEM_ID NUMBER(19,0) not null,
   TITLE VARCHAR2(255) not null,
   TEXT VARCHAR2(255) not null,
   DATE_TIME DATE not null,
   BLOG_ID NUMBER(19,0) not null,
   primary key (BLOG_ITEM_ID)
)

create table BLOGS (
   BLOG_ID NUMBER(19,0) not null,
   NAME VARCHAR2(255) not null unique,
   primary key (BLOG_ID)
)

alter table BLOG_ITEMS add constraint FK5FDFB8C329868AD8 foreign key (BLOG_ID) references BLOGS

create sequence hibernate_sequence

当然   join 查询还是同样的错误信息。
0 请登录后投票
   发表时间:2003-12-24  
此问题我在Mysql数据库做了测试,可以顺利通过,  不过oracle还是不能.
0 请登录后投票
   发表时间:2003-12-26  
就是因为Dialect设置成了Oracle9Dialect!!
0 请登录后投票
论坛首页 Java企业应用版

跳转论坛:
Global site tag (gtag.js) - Google Analytics